It’s official: NKOTBSB is back. Backstreet Boys and New Kids on the Block are reuniting once again, sending waves of nostalgia and excitement across generations of fans. After weeks of speculation and subtle hints on social media, the two iconic boy bands have confirmed a brand-new joint tour, complete with full dates and cities. For many, this announcement feels like stepping back into a golden era of pop — only bigger, louder, and more electrifying than ever before.
The original NKOTBSB tour was more than just a concert series; it was a cultural moment that brought together two of the most influential pop groups of all time. Now, years later, the reunion promises to recapture that magic while introducing it to a new generation. Both groups have continued to tour and release music independently, but there’s something undeniably special about seeing them share the same stage, trading verses and harmonizing on era-defining hits.
Fans can expect a hit-packed setlist that spans decades. From the smooth harmonies of “I Want It That Way” to the infectious energy of “You Got It (The Right Stuff),” the upcoming tour is shaping up to be a nonstop celebration of pop excellence. The chemistry between the members — playful, competitive, and deeply rooted in shared history — is part of what makes NKOTBSB shows so memorable. It’s not just about nostalgia; it’s about reliving the soundtrack of countless memories in real time.
The newly revealed tour dates cover major cities across North America, with additional international stops expected to follow. Stadiums and arenas are already preparing for high demand, and ticket presales are anticipated to sell out quickly. From New York and Los Angeles to Chicago, Toronto, and beyond, fans across the country will have the chance to experience this larger-than-life collaboration live.
